Holding Realty Income REIT in a Roth IRA shelters monthly dividends from IRS taxes, boosting investor returns.

Realty Income, a REIT paying monthly dividends, distributes cash that is taxed as ordinary income in taxable accounts but is tax-free in a Roth IRA after qualified distribution conditions are met. For example, a $500,000 investment yielding 5.67% generates $27,000 annually; in a 24% tax bracket, $6,480 would go to taxes in a taxable account, but none in a Roth IRA, preserving the full amount for reinvestment. This tax shelter effect compounds over time, significantly increasing long-term returns. Investors are advised to consider holding REITs like Realty Income in Roth IRAs to maximize after-tax income and growth potential.
